Jewellery (Luohu, Shenzhen)
Shuibei in Luohu, Shenzhen, is widely recognized in China's gold and jewelry industry. Within its 0.1074 square kilometers, there are nearly 7,000 legal entities engaged in the gold and jewelry industry, generating annual revenues exceeding 100 billion yuan. This represents approximately 50% of the market share in the domestic wholesale gold and jewelry market. The physical gold usage in Shuibei accounts for about 70% of the physical delivery volume of the Shanghai Gold Exchange, while diamond usage accounts for approximately 80% of the import value at the Shanghai Diamond Exchange.
In 1981, Shenzhen saw the establishment of its first "three come, one compensate" enterprise in the gold and jewelry industry, which involved processing supplied materials, assembling supplied items, processing samples, and compensation trade. These businesses started producing 24-karat gold jewelry, filling a gap in Shenzhen's gold and jewelry manufacturing capabilities. Subsequently, through a transition from imitation to production, numerous local gold and jewelry brands emerged in Shenzhen. Today, more than 2,400 renowned gold and jewelry brands across the country originated from Shuibei.
